the piston ( dished) ,and muffler , on the 261 epa model is s bit plugged in stock form, the 2-3 shoe clutch is not a (big) issue

I converted one this spring and in my opinion of the 3 changes listed in ordered of biggest power bump were muffler mod, clutch and lastly piston. With the 2 shoe clutch mine would bog pretty easy. Totally different saw with the 3 shoe.

Clutches are totally overlooked. When people soup up cars... they upgrade the transmission/clutch to handle the power. If you have the option to upgrade the clutch on a saw when modding it... take advantage of that opportunity is what I say. It puts the power to the chain.
